网络层提供的服务
负责在不同网路(网段)之间转发数据包,基于数据包的IP地址转发,不负责丢失重传,不负责顺序。
数据包在互联网中的传送
互联网络与虚拟互联网络
网络设备和OSI参考模型的关系
计算通信的过程 本网段通信和跨网段通信的过程。
发送端:
- 应用程序 准备要传输的文件
- 传输层 将文件分段并编号
- 网络层 添加 目标IP地址 和 源IP地址
- 数据链路层 两种情况 使用自己的子网掩码 判断自己在哪个网段
使用自己的子网掩码 判断目标地址目标IP地址是否在自己所在的网段
如果目标IP地址和自己在同一个网段,则使用arp协议广播询问目标IP地址对应计算机的MAC地址
- 物理层 将数据转换为比特流
TCP/IP协议之间层次
网络层协议
ARP协议 —> IP协议 —> ICMP协议 —> IGMP协议
ARP协议:将IP地址通过广播,目标MAC地址是FF-FF-FF-FF-FF-FF,解析目标IP地址的MAC地址。
扫描本网段MAC地址。